BIRTH:Missouri State Birth Certificate, no. 388729 MARRIAGE:Marriage Certificate, no. 3118 When Effie Ellen Nettles Edgmond Altman's funeral was held 13 Feb. 1971 she could not be buried that day as the roads to the Pleasantview Cemetery were flooded, therefore she was buried six days later when the roads were passable. (Told to Louise Christina Glantz England by Mary Ellen Edgmond England) Obituary: Mrs. Effie Edgmond Altman, 82, wife of Adolph Altman, 931 Cook Ave., died Saturday at St. Vincent's Hospital after an extended illness. She was born March 27, 1888, in Cedar Grove, Mo., a daughter of Mr. and Mrs. Granville Nettles. She was raised in Missouri and married there. She moved to the Ballantine area in 1910. In 1934 she moved to Billings. She was married to Adolph Altman April 2, 1949, in Columbus. They made their home in Billings where Mrs. Altman was a member of the Trinity Lutheran Church. Funeral Services will be 1 p.m. Tuesday from Michelotti-Sawyers Mortuary with the Rev. Paul Frieburger, pastor of Trinity Lutheran Church, officiating. Burial will be in Pleasantville Cemetery, Ballantine. Survivors include the widower; two sons, G.J. Edgmond, Helena, and W.J. Edgmond, Bridger; five daughters, Mrs. Mary England, 923 Cook Ave., Mrs. Ben Burkart, 1245 Landscape Drive, Mrs. Alfred Weinzetl, 1742 Columbine Drive, Mrs. Don Summerfelt, Helena, and Mrs. Art Fossum, Clyde Park; one sister, Mrs. John Edgmond, Neoshoe, Mo.; 16 grandchildren; and 26 great-grandchildren.

1910 census Jackson Twp, Shannon, MO. "Julia married first Jacob A. Schafer, he and a child died in the flu epidemic of 1918, Julia married second a Bradford and is said to have had a son James." -Louise C. England Feb. 1991 "In 1920, William [Bradford] married Julia (Nettles) Schafer of Cedar Grove. Twin sons were born, the mother dying soon after. One twin died. The surviving one, Wayne, married Aleene Nicholson (deceased)...." -History of Shannon Co., MO 1986 pg. 77 pub: Friends of the Shannon Co. Libraries, Eminence, MO (See Nettles File) Louise C. England notes that Julia married William Bradford on 26 Jan 1920, but did not find her on the 1920 Census. (William Bradford's census enumerated 12 Jan 1920). Julia's parents census was enumerated 29 Jan 1920. If she were living with her parents before her marriage and then with her husband after her marriage, she missed the census taker altogether Death date & place, burial: Death Certificate. He married Alice Irene Cole 24 Dec 1882 at Jackson Twp, Shannon, Missouri . Alice Irene Cole was born at Montauk, Dent, Missouri 17 Mar 1863 daughter of James F. Cole and Elizabeth "Betsy" Razor .
They were the parents of 7
children:
Lenora M. "Nora" Nettles
born 12 Sep 1883.
Bessie Nettles
born 26 Nov 1885.
Effie Ellen Nettles
born 27 Mar 1888.
James Palmer Nettles
born 10 Jul 1893.
Lon Milo Nettles
born 19 Oct 1895.
Julia Amie Nettles
born 31 Jul 1897.
Minnie Maude Nettles
born 29 Sep 1900.
Zebulon Granville Nettles died 20 Dec 1936 at Current Twp, Texas, Missouri .
Alice Irene Cole died 17 Oct 1954 at Nevada, Vernon, Missouri .
